试题详情
- 简答题链栈中为何不设置头结点?
- 链栈不需要在头部附加头结点,因为栈都是在头部进行操作的,如果加了头结点,等于要对头结点之后的结点进行操作,反而使算法更复杂,所以只要有链表的头指针就可以了。
关注下方微信公众号,在线模考后查看
热门试题
- 一个顺序栈一旦说明,其占用空间的大小()
- 每次从无序表中挑选出一个最小或最大元素,
- 数组Q[n]用来表示一个循环队列,fro
- 十字链表是图的一种存储结构,是由邻接表和
- 单链表的存储密度()
- 模式串T=’abcaabbcabcaab
- 一棵深度为h的满二叉树具有如下性质:第h
- 若需要利用形参直接访问实参,则应把形参变
- 字符串a1=〝BEIJING〞,a2=〝
- 要从一个顺序表删除一个元素时,被删除元素
- 已知循环队列的存储空间为数组data[2
- 数据结构被形式地定义为<D,R>,其中R
- 数据
- 双向链表的结点中有()个指针域,其一指向
- 在单链表中,若要在指针P所指结点后插入指
- 简述Dijkstra算法的作用和具体步骤
- 对于线性表(70,34,55,23,65
- 就平均查找长度而言,分块查找最小,折半查
- 算法不应具有可行性。
- 数据的逻辑结构是指:()